I generate all setup files (msvc/mingw 32/64) under windows7 64bits.
I have found a problem: create_bat.exe is a 64bits executable. However
even when fixing it the created setup does not run under XP 32 bits.
Even a simple file compiled with Visual Studio 32 bits does not run
under XP... I cannot explain it.
My advice is : get the source tarball and compile it manually under XP
(look at the file src/WINDOWS and src/WINDOWS64 which also contains
information for 32 bits).

Trying to install gprolog from setup-gprolog-1.4.4-msvc-x86.exe I'm
facing a lot of troubles:
"Unable to execute file : create_bat.exe"
"CreateProcess failed; code 193"
"%1 is not a Win32 valid application"
What is the proper way to have gprolog up and running on windows XP
(SP3).
